      ๐Ÿ˜ It works a treat ! Thanks again for the advice.

      In Illustrator, after adding plenty more nodes (Object menu) one goes back th the same menu for "Simplify" then choose "straight lines" (in fact I use a French set up, I assume those are the English terms used in the menus).
      Once in Sketchup, the Makefaces plug-in is essential to enable push-pull extrusion.
      All this enables one to convert vectorized texte or logos into 3D forms. Cool.
